Transaction 4f17b23d33a58895dba110d8a8c58d1eb31d852b7ecc71af252fc1c62da05fca
1 Input
1 Output
-
4f17b23d33a58895dba110d8a8c58d1eb31d852b7ecc71af252fc1c62da05fca:0
- value
- 101795603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cb299ad3c1afdacb4a2ef7d68acc48611d71ea2 OP_EQUAL
- address
- 3QjAAFXvEeBRaD8apjHqy7oALvpTUqFiyW